As a statement of our commitment to ethics and compliance, Eisai has set forth a Charter of Business Conduct for all affiliates throughout the world.

To further ensure that our directors, officers and employees exhibit integrity and a positive image that reflects our mission and values, Eisai has established a Comprehensive Compliance Program (CCP). It incorporates the elements of:

  • United States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) Office of Inspector General (OIG) Compliance Program Guidance for Pharmaceutical Manufacturers
  • U.S. Department of Justice's Evaluation of Corporate Compliance Programs
  • Pharmaceutical Research and Manufacturers of America (PhRMA) Code on Interactions with Healthcare Practitioners

Our CCP also complies with the requirements of Chapter 8, Section 119400 of the California Health and Safety Code. View our declaration of compliance

Eisai insists that all of our employees, contractors and agents comply with our Comprehensive Compliance Program.

8 ESSENTIAL WAYS WE MAINTAIN THE HIGHEST ETHICAL STANDARDS

  • 1 — STAY EVER-VIGILANT ABOUT COMPLIANCE

    Our CCP is overseen by the Chief Ethics and Compliance Officer. The Compliance Officer is a member of the Executive Committee and regularly reports to that committee and the Global Compliance Committee regarding implementation of the Compliance Program. These committees provide input and oversight of compliance initiatives and ongoing programs on a regular basis. In addition to the oversight provided by these committees, the Compliance Officer reports regularly to the U.S. Board of Directors.

  • 2 — ESTABLISH COMPREHENSIVE POLICIES

    Eisai’s Compliance Handbook sets forth the legal and ethical standards and values that guide all Eisai colleagues worldwide in their daily activities.

    Additionally, Eisai has adopted policies to address our legal and regulatory requirements, including policies to ensure that all interactions with health care providers (HCPs) focus on appropriate informational, scientific and educational exchanges.

  • 3 — EDUCATE AND TRAIN

    Eisai’s learning program is designed to help our employees understand their legal and ethical obligations and specific requirements that impact their daily job responsibilities. In addition, we’ve created a communication and training program to ensure that colleagues are up to date on their training requirements and know how to access policies and procedures that impact their jobs.

  • 4 — ENCOURAGE HEALTHY, FREE-FLOWING INTERNAL DIALOGUE

    The channels of communication run both ways at Eisai.

    We keep our employees informed about policy changes, new compliance initiatives and training programs through:

    • Internal communications
    • Company intranet postings
    • Communications from senior management that are cascaded through the organization

    Eisai expects our employees and our business associates to act with integrity at all times. We strive for consistent standards and accountability, and encourage open and honest dialogue on how we can build upon our company culture and better fulfill our corporate mission. In that spirit, Eisai has established the Eisai Integrity Line which is available 24/7 either online or toll free (1-800-467-1391) to anyone who has a question or would like to report a concern.

  • 5 — CONSTANTLY AUDIT AND MONITOR

    We follow OIG Guidance in managing the way we audit and monitor compliance because regulatory requirements, business practices and other factors change frequently. We review our monitoring program each year and augment it regularly to ensure that it’s focused on significant business activities and risks.

  • 6 — ENFORCEMENT OF STANDARDS

    Our policies clearly state the consequences of violating law, regulations and company policies, as well as failure to report instances of non-compliance to state and federal authorities, where required or appropriate. Although each situation is unique and considered on a case-by-case basis, we’re unwaveringly committed to taking appropriate disciplinary action to address misconduct and deter future violations.

  • 7 — TAKE CORRECTIVE ACTION

    Our responsibility as a human health care company is to act swiftly and decisively to address and deter misconduct. As a result, we’re committed to responding promptly to potential violations of law, regulations or company policies, and to taking appropriate disciplinary and corrective actions whenever and wherever necessary.

  • 8 — MAINTAIN TRUE TRANSPARENCY

    We’re committed to meeting our obligations regarding disclosures, including payments and/or other transfers of value provided by Eisai or our agents to certain health care professionals and health care organizations.
